Hi everyone..a friend of mine is heading on the Wonder in March. She is part of a larger group and is looking for an inexpensive (but safe - nice) beach day. She figures Atlantis would cost too much for the group. Any suggestions??
Cabbage Beach is free. It's about ¾ mile down the road past Atlantis, and is basically the "same" beach that Atlantis-goers pay to use. However, there are no amenities there, you're on your own for food, restrooms, etc. You *could* always walk down to Atlantis if you really wanted.
Cable Beach is public but not "free", from what I've read. I believe you have to pay one of the hotels at Cable Beach for access (I've read it's $15 per person at the Wyndham)... however, in return you have amenities available, like restaurants, restrooms, and someone even said there's a casino nearby.
Each beach is super-easy to get to -- just get a taxi from the port terminal, right when you get off the ship. The taxis charge $4 per person, each way.
